3 Simple Rules for Making the Most of Your Visit to Disneyland

Disneyland thumbnail I have visited both Disneyland and California Adventure a number of times over the last 20 years and can clearly say that both parks have become much busier over the years. This busy-ness translates in very long wait times for most of the attractions. This also means that you cannot really see every attraction in one day…no matter what day of the year you go. However, there are some simple things you can do in order to avoid the peak visiting times and enjoy your visit to Disneyland a lot more. California Adventure Park is a true amusement park.

California Adventure ParkWe took advantage of the 2Fer ticket for Southern California residents when we visited Disneyland on Easter weekend. So, two weeks after visiting Disneyland during Spring Break, we came back to visit California Adventure for FREE ! This was a great deal indeed. The simple fact that we came after Spring Break made our experience a lot better than what we went through when visiting Disneyland.
